After having lost a blowout in their previous game against Luverne, Blacksher was happy to have turned things around on Wednesday. They sure made it a nail-biter, but they managed to escape with a 7-5 victory over the Ariton Purple Cats. That's more bragging rights for Blacksher, who also won the pair's last head-to-head.
The team relied heavily on Moira Gleeson, who scored two runs while going 3-for-4. Averie Hall was another key contributor, going 1-for-2 with a double and an RBI.
Blacksher is on a roll lately: they've won five of their last six matchups, which provided a massive bump to their 21-15 record this season. As for Ariton, they are on a four-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 23-20.
Blacksher didn't take long to hit the field again: they've already played their next match, a 4-3 loss vs. Zion Chapel on the 9th. Ariton does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
